Tue 3rd Apr 2018 - Be At One promotes Andrew Stones to MD, reports Ebitda boost as turnover exceeds £40m
Be At One promotes Andrew Stones to MD, reports Ebitda boost as turnover exceeds £40m: Cocktail bar specialist Be At One has made a trio of key strategic appointments as it looks to further accelerate its growth. The appointments come as the business closes out another record financial year with total sales exceeding £40m compared with £36.9m the previous year, Ebitda increasing to £5.7m compared with £5.1m the year before and, as previously reported by Propel, like-for-like sales up 7%. The group, which operates 33 bars across the UK including 17 in London, has promoted Andrew Stones from chief operating officer to managing director. Stones joined the business seven years ago following a number of senior roles across the sector and has worked closely alongside the three founding directors and wider management team in driving the business forward over that period. The group has also appointed Adam Gregory as operations director and Gillian Lambden as people director. Gregory joins from natural fast food brand Leon where he was director of restaurants. This followed a five-year period at Wagamama where he held senior operational roles in both the UK and the US. Prior to that he worked for Welcome Break and in a variety of managerial roles at TGI Friday’s. Lambden has spent six years in senior HR roles with a number of leading hospitality sector brands, most recently at Franco Manca, which is owned by Fulham Shore; and previously healthy Asian food chain Itsu. She also has a background in operations management for grab-and-go concepts such as EAT and Pret A Manger. Chairman Mark Derry said: “These key appointments signal a strong statement of intent for the business as we celebrate the important milestone of our 20th anniversary year. I am delighted Andrew has moved into his new role to lead Be At One as we look to embark on the next chapter of our exciting growth journey. Since he joined the business in 2011, Andrew has made an invaluable contribution and I’m absolutely convinced under his leadership the Be At One brand will continue to go from strength to strength. Furthermore, both Adam and Gillian bring with them wide-ranging experience and industry expertise which will undoubtedly enhance our capability from both an operational and people development perspective.” Be At One was founded in 1998 by Steve Locke, Leigh Miller and Rhys Oldfield, who remain as executive directors of the business. Stones previously told Propel the company plans to open up to seven sites in 2018.
